Queen Elizabeth and Murchison Falls
National Park- 5 Days
 |
Day 1 Kampala - Queen Elizabeth
National Park
After breakfast you will picked from your hotel or residence and depart
for Lake Mburo National Park stopping at Mpigi crafts and the Equator
crossing. Arrive in time for lunch stop in Mbarara and then proceed to
Queen Elizabeth National Park. As you descend to the park stop for good
scenery point of the rift valley and Rwenzori mountains. Arrive in the
evening and check in at Mweya Safari Lodge or Institute Hostel for dinner
and overnight.
Day 2: Queen Elizabeth National Park
After breakfast, you will go for Chimpanzee trekking in Kyambura Gorge
where you will see not only the chimpanzee but also other primates like
the colobus monkeys, vervet monkeys plus baboons. Return to the lodge
for lunch and after you will take an afternoon boat cruise on the Kazinga
Channel where you will see a variety of game mostly marine animals. This
waterway joins Lake Edward and Lake George and it is filled with schools
of hippos, buffaloes, with elephants at the banks. Queen Elizabeth National
Park is one of the most outstanding treasures of Uganda, and has been
designated a Biosphere Reserve for Humanity under UNESCO auspices. If
time allows take an evening game drive to the crater area. Retire to your
lodge for Dinner and Overnight.
 |
Day 3: Queen Elizabeth National
Park - Murchison Falls Game Park
Check out of the lodge carryout morning game drive to catch-up with the
early risers and predators – lion, leopard, returning to their hideouts.
You will be likely to meet grazing, elephants, spotted hyenas and leopards,
bushbucks, water buck and stripped jackal, and of-course the several warthogs.
Proceed to Murchison Falls National Park with packed lunch or stopping
in Hoima for lunch . Proceed to Murchison falls arriving in the evening.Check
in at Paraa safari Lodge or Sambiya River Lodge or Nile safari camp .
Day 4: Murchison
Falls Game Park
Start the day with an early morning game drive on the Buligi, Albert or
Queens tracks north of the river Nile. You are able to view those animals
that are unique to the African Savannah like lion, leopard, giraffe, antelope,
elephant, and many warthogs. After lunch, you will go for a launch cruise
on the Nile River. The cruise takes to the bottom of the thundering falls
where you will see huge crocodiles, schools of hippos, buffaloes, elephants
and a variety of water birds like herons, cormorants, ducks, bee-eaters,
kingfishers, skimmers, fish eagle and the rare shoebill. Return to the
lodge for dinner and overnight.
Day 5: Murchison
Falls Game Park - Kampala
On this day before you leave the park, visit the “Top of the falls”
and proceed to Kampala.

Jinja, Lake Mburo and Queen Elizabeth -
5 Days
.JPG) |
Day 1 Kampala - River Nile - Kampala
Morning at 7:00 AM will picked from designated point to be driven to Jinja
an old colonial industrial town of Uganda set up at the source of the
River Nile at the shores of Lake Victoria. This day is dedicated to white
water rafting on River Nile- day. Lunch will be served while rafting and
at the end will be served a barbeque. Clients who will not go for rafting
will visit the source of River Nile, Bujagali Falls and proceed to Kampala
overnight.
Day 2 Jinja/Kampala—Lake Mburo National Park
After breakfast you will picked from your hotel or residence and depart
for Lake Mburo National Park stopping at Mpigi crafts and the Equator
crossing. Arrive in time for an evening game drive/ boat ride where you
will see unique game like the Eland, Topi, Klipspringer and Zebra. The
attractive acacia-dotted Savannah is a home for huge Zebras and Buffaloes
which graze these peaceful acres .At the lake, there are Hippos and a
wonderful diversity of birds. Because of the different habitats of the
lakeshores and the broad Savannah, the variety seems endless. Catch a
glimpse of water birds diving for fish, the Marabou stork, bee-eater and
cheeky bronze-tailed starling as well as the majestic crowned crane. Check
in at Mantana Luxury camp or Rwonyo Camp for dinner and overnight
Day 3 Lake Mburo -Queen Elizabeth
National Park
Morning game drive /boat ride which you did not do yesterday.Drive southwards
with packed lunch or sto for lunch in Mbarara town. As you descend to
the park stop for strategic view of scenery and sight seeing point of
the rift valley and the Rwenzori mountains. Arrive in the evening and
check in at Mweya Safari Lodge or Institute Hostel for dinner and overnight.
